Kant's model of epistemology, with humans schematizing conceptual understanding of objects through apperception of manifold impressions from our sensibility, and then reasoning about these objects using transcendental application of the categories, is a reasonable enough model of thought. It was (and is I think) a satisfactory answer for the question of how humans can produce synthetic a priori knowledge, something that LLMs are incapable of (don't take my word on that though, ChatGPT is more than happy to discuss [1]) 1: https://chatgpt.com/share/6965653e-b514-8011-b233-79d8c25d33... | ||
